ROMANIA
* RADIO ROMANIA INTERNATIONAL, Bucharest; transmissions to EUROPE:
   In English:
    0641-.... on 7105, 9510, 9625 and 11775 kHz,
    1300-1400 on 15390 and 17745 kHz,
    2100-2200 on 5955, 5990, 6175, and 7195 kHz,
    2300-2400 on 5955 and 7195 kHz.
   In French:
    0613-.... on 7105, 9510, 9625 and 11775 kHz.
   In German:
    0628-.... on 7105, 9510, 9625 and 11775 kHz.
    1200-1300 on 9690, 11940 and 15390 kHz,
    1600-1700 on 6175, 7195 and 9690 kHz,
    1900-2000 on 5955, 6040, 7145 and 7195 kHz.
   (RWo via CJO, 07-Dec-97)
 
U.S.A.
* WHRI, South Bend; schedule of "DXing with Cumbre", valid as from
   17th december 1997:
   Via WHRI Angel 1 (To Americas/Caribbean):
    0600-0630(Sat) on 7315 kHz,
    1330-1400(Sun) on 15105 kHz,
    1830-1900(Sat) and 2330-2400(Sat) on 9495 kHz.
   Via WHRI Angel 2 (To EUROPE/Middle East/Africa/Russia/N.America):
    0600-0630(Sat), 0530-0600(Sun) and 0930-1000(Sun) on 5760 kHz,
    1530-1600(Sat) and 1830-1900(Sun) on 13760 kHz,
    2300-2330(Sat) on 5745 kHz.
   Via KWHR Angel 3 - Hawaii (To Asia/Pacific):
    0230-0300(Sat) on 17510 kHz,
    1130-1200(Sat) and 1630-1700(Sun) on 9930 kHz,
    1830-1900(Sun) on 13625 kHz.
   Via KWHR Angel 4 - Hawaii (To S.Pacific):
    0330-0400(Sun) on 17555 kHz,
    0730-0800(Sun) and 0800-0830(Sat) on 11565 kHz,
    1300-1330(Sun) on 7560  kHz,
    1830-1900(Sun) on 13760 kHz,
    2000-2030(Sat) and 2130-2200(Sun) on 17555 kHz.
   (Direct via MAL, 17/12/97)
